10 Tips to Save Money in Triathlon
Triathlon doesn’t have to cost thousands of dollars to enjoy. In this episode, I’m sharing 10 practical tips that have helped me save money while training for marathons, triathlons, and my journey toward Ironman. As someone training on a budget, I’ve learned that you don’t need the most expensive gear to become a stronger athlete. I’ll talk about where it’s worth investing, where you can save, and how to make endurance sports more accessible without sacrificing your goals. Whether you’re training for your first sprint triathlon or dreaming of completing an Ironman someday, I hope these tips help you enjoy the sport while keeping more money in your pocket. In this episode, we’ll cover: How to prioritize your spending Which equipment is worth buying used Ways to save on race entries and travel Affordable training tools that really work How to avoid unnecessary purchases Why consistency matters more than expensive gear Remember: It’s never too late to chase a dream, and it doesn’t have to break the bank. 11 Freestyle Swimming Tips for Adult Beginners
Learning freestyle as an adult can feel intimidating—but I want you to know that you’re not alone. In this episode, I’m sharing 11 practical freestyle swimming tips that completely changed my own swimming journey. Unlike many coaches who learned to swim as children, I didn’t truly learn freestyle until adulthood. Because of that, I understand the fears, frustrations, and challenges that many adult beginners experience when they first get into the pool. Whether you’re training for your first triathlon, looking to become a more confident swimmer, or simply want to improve your technique, these are the lessons I wish someone had shared with me when I was starting out.
